Transaction 58581837401b077fd9d62718b740408d8d5a802314139bc6c199cc4362945c34
1 Input
1 Output
-
58581837401b077fd9d62718b740408d8d5a802314139bc6c199cc4362945c34:0
- value
- 3335512
- script pubkey
- OP_0 OP_PUSHBYTES_20 9c7be426a694ccb7183daca4986e6e1af65f1455
- address
- bc1qn3a7gf4xjnxtwxpa4jjfsmnwrtm979z4tlq8v3